Orienteering - Forest race (Lancaster Uni Score) 56:25 [5] 10.64 km (5:18 / km) +180m 4:53 / km
ahr:144 max:161 shoes: Xtalon 212 (navy/orange)

Odds/evens score. Max points, but too slow to win (5th when I left).

Mistake right at the start, terrible control order choice which I realised quite fast but it meant I had to get one on an out and back which was totally avoidable. Lost about 2:30.

Then one more bad choice, left an even until last when I should've got it straight after the odds. It was in the wrong direction but I was already at the top of the hill it was on, and also significantly harder to get to from the bottom. Rest of the controls all fine, but then approaching this one at the end from the bottom, theres a path on the map which very much doesn't exist on the ground (it looks like it might've in the past, but very distant past!) between a hedge and a fence, and so I had to climb the fence twice and squeeze through a different hedge which isn't even on the map. Anyway apart from getting scratched to pieces that ludicrousness also lost me about 2:30 and so my 56 could've been 51. Not sure what the winning time was yet.

Good fun after parkrun and good use of the area. Em really enjoyed it. Plus we have more o tomorrow too which is a proper urban.

Running - Trail race (Bowstones) 47:32 [5] 10.74 km (4:26 / km) +338m 3:50 / km
ahr:152 max:163 shoes: Mudclaw 275 (blk)

15th/416
https://crazylegsevents.co.uk/results

Thought this went well so disappointed to be 45s slower than the last time I did it.
Looking at the splits, faster on the first quarter but slower on the second, to be 10s ish behind at the Bowstones. Then 15s down through the woods and 15s on the remainder.
It was significantly muddier this time, which is my excuse. Felt very out of breath on the climbs, legs fine though.

Over the stile since there was no queue. Last time there was a queue of 1, and I went through the dog hole and came out together with the stile guy. So it's pretty similar either way.

Enjoyed it, and good turnout of MaccH.

Orienteering - Urban race (York University) 37:58 [5] 8.21 km (4:37 / km) +62m 4:27 / km
ahr:144 max:162 shoes: Pegasus Trail 3

Good area, not as good use of it made this time I didn't think. 3rd behind Jack and Ben Stevens. Not quite enough ranking points to make it into my top 6 and so I'm still tantalisingly close to (re)breaking into the top 100, at 102nd.

This was my last event as an M21 :(

Fairly poor start missing a gap and then ending up the wrong side of some olive, and then failed to include road crossing requirement in planning the next leg. From there though, pretty good. I think missed the best route on 7, possibly anchored by going the way I'd come into 6. Didn't do much else wrong I don't think - Jack and BS both running a bit faster (Jack a lot faster, plus a 60s mistake). Not a lot of 50/50 route choice going on; I imagine that the best route was taken by most people in most cases, so running speed was pretty important today.
